A Marrow and Leek soup recipe



Google
 




Ingredients


Marrow and leek soup

Soupe de courge

serves 6

600g / 1lb 3 ozs marrow peeled and diced

500g / 1lb potatoes peeled and diced

3 leeks trimmed and sliced

2 medium onions thinly sliced

4 tablespoons of oil

salt and pepper

grated nutmeg

croutons to serve


Heat the oil in a large pan cook the onions and leeks until transparent.

Without allowing them to brown add the marrow and potatoes heat through.

Add 1.5 ltrs of hot water to the pan and seasoning.

Cover and simmer for 15 to 20 mins.

Then rub through a sieve or puree in a blender.

Serve very hot with croutons.
